Elder travels to take on Indianapolis Bishop Chatard

This week Elder travels up I-74 into Indianapolis to take on Bishop Chatard High School. Chatard, who is 7-1 this season, look to end their season on the right note by defeating the Panthers. Chatard has not won in the four meetings between the schools. In 2000 Elder won 40-16, in 2003 Elder won 17-16, in 2004 Elder won 21-15, and last season the Panthers defeated the Trojans 35-13.
Elder comes off of a tough week, and an even tougher game against Moeller. On the opening kickoff senior co-captain Casey Lysaght (OL) went down with a knee injury, and later on in the game fellow senior Troy Skeens (OL) had to be removed because of a concussion. both will be on the sidelines this week, leaving an already shaky offensive line with some huge gaps.
Overall, the Panthers need to come out and make a statement with this game. If Elder loses, there won't be a week 11 game for the second straight year in a row at Elder. The playoffs start on Friday night, at Broad Ripple High School, where the game will take place for Elder. Every week from here on in is a playoff game. Hopefully, the Panthers can corral Chatard senior RB joe Holland, who last season rushed 27 times for 246 yards on the Panther's defense. Elder will once again rely on the legs of senior RB Patrick Williams, and look to spread the ball around to its talented WR corps. This game has been close in prior years, and Elder will need to bring their intensity, and best game to beat the Trojans.
